Definitions:

One-Stop Shopping

A retail convenience concept where customers can meet all their buying needs in a single location, saving time and effort.

Specialty Outlet

A retail store that focuses on selling a specific category of products or services, often characterized by a high level of expertise and customer service.

Scrambled Merchandise Store

Retail outlets that carry a wide range of products outside of their traditional merchandise lines, expanding their offerings to increase foot traffic and sales.

General Merchandise Store

A retail establishment offering a wide range of products across different categories, typically without a specialty focus.
